Antony Costa is desperate for Blue to reform.
The singer admits he would love to see the boys - himself, Lee Ryan Simon Webbe and Duncan James - get back together.
He said: "I'd like to think it could happen. We wanted to take time out and do out own thing, but it would be good to be like the Backstreet Boys - you know, go our own ways for a few years then come back together and make a new album."
Despite not having seen each other for months, Antony says the four former band mates still keep in touch regularly on the phone and are close friends.
He added to Britain's Funday Times: "I haven't seen them for a few months but we keep in touch either by phone or text message.
